Abstract
Câbles électriques résistant au feu. Le câble électrique selon l'invention comprend au moins un conducteur isolé par une matière polymère, une couche d'enrobage entourant le conducteur isolé, et une gaine d'enveloppement en matière peu inflammable, la couche d'enrobage étant constituée par une composition comprenant un copolymère éthylène/acétate de vinyle, au moins 55 % de charge minérale inerte et un antioxydant
